Break-glass: notification fan-out backpressure (Tindercap)

Quick notes for the sync. When the Tindercap fan-out queue backs up past the red line, consumers start shedding low-priority notifications, which is fine — but if the lag keeps climbing, someone needs break-glass access to pause producers. Don't do this casually; it pages the on-call lead automatically. To activate the break-glass session on the Emberly console, use the recovery passphrase below.

vault phrase of taweg-kafof = oliax-zorael

### Action Item: Spoolhaven Retry Storm

From last Tuesday's outage: the Spoolhaven print service retried failed jobs without backoff, saturating the render pool. Fix merged; retries now use capped exponential backoff with jitter. Owner will monitor for a week before closing. The agreed retry constants are recorded below.

constants for yadup-kajof:
RATE_LIMITS = {
    "zorwyn": 1,
    "druwyn": 1,
}

## HSM delivery — quick guide for shift leads

The Cindervale hardware security module arrives this week via Stonepath Couriers in a tamper-evident case. Don't stack anything on it, don't open it, and log it straight into the secure cage. Two-person check on the seals, please. Before signing anything, give the courier the confidential hand-over instruction listed directly below.

drop instructions, yafog-yawip: the quenmir olidor courier leaves the julox tamion keliel ledger at gate 5283 under passcode 336825